Didn't get round to doing the 12v outlets but managed the UHF install, fusebox and 2nd battery. If I get some time next weekend, will look at doing the 12v sockets.
2nd battery setup was the quickest by far due to the excellent instructions provided with it. Modifying the bracket was a bit of a hack job but it works..
Manage to run the power and antenna cable under the carpet in the drivers footwell, there is a space there.
Only mistake I've made which set me back was running the antenna cable then working out that you needed to thread it through the antenna bracket first.. Getting the antenna cable through the firewall insulation was fun to.
I put the fusebox and UHF under the drivers set in a plastic container.
